Jayson Tatum’s struggle to find late-game heroics this season has looked downright Sisyphus-like. The Celtics superstar has pocketed his share of signature playoff games during his young NBA career, but his ability to beat the buzzer or just command the final minute of a close game has lacked during an otherwise pristine 2023-24 regular season.
Scal talks Mike Gorman, scary East opponents
“Clutch” sounds like sports radio jargon, but it’s actually an NBA statistic: the association categorizes clutch shooting as any shot taken in the final five minutes of the game in which the score differential is within five points.
Tatum’s effective field goal percentage (both 2- and 3-pointers) sits at 51% in NBA clutch situations, or slightly above the league standard of 47%. Where he comes up short is best encapsulated by a statistic formed by the actuary geniuses at inpredictable.com. The stat is called “double clutch,” and is defined as shots “crucial to game outcome, or the top 1% impact in potential win probability.”
“Double clutch shots are intended to be the highlight reel shots; the ones that build, or destroy, a player's legacy,” inpredictable.com explains.
Double clutch shots typically happen around or within the last two minutes of the game, with a point differential within two scores.
Tatum has had 19 shot attempts in this category, which is in line with most other NBA stars playing at guard or wing, and his numbers speak for themselves when stacked against the other NBA players competing in the 2024 playoffs with at least 12 double clutch shot attempts. These are the most clutch shooters in the playoffs based on the regular season and play-in tournament:
1. LeBron James
Clutch: 55%, Double clutch: 67% in 12 attempts
2. Shai Gilgeous-Alexander
Clutch: 53%, Double clutch: 57% in 15 attempts
3. Malik Monk
Clutch: 50%, Double clutch: 54% in 14 attempts
4. De’Aaron Fox
Clutch: 51%, Double clutch: 50% in 22 attempts
5. Anthony Edwards
Clutch: 50%, Double clutch: 50% in 15 attempts
6. Jalen Brunson
Clutch: 45%, Double clutch: 48% in 20 attempts
7. Coby White
Clutch: 54%, Double clutch: 46% in 13 attempts
8. Donovan Mitchell
Clutch: 50%, Double clutch: 46% in 12 attempts
9. Nikola Jokic
Clutch: 61%, Double clutch: 46% in 12 attempts
10. DeMar DeRozan
Clutch: 48%, Double clutch: 42% in 26 attempts
11. Kevin Durant
Clutch: 50%, Double clutch: 41% in 17 attempts
12. Karl-Anthony Towns
Clutch: 53%, Double clutch: 39% in 13 attempts
13. Damian Lillard
Clutch: 53%, Double clutch: 38% in 20 attempts
14. Dejounte Murray
Clutch: 49%, Double clutch: 36% in 14 attempts
15. Tyrese Maxey
Clutch: 49%, Double clutch: 36% in 14 attempts
16. Trae Young
Clutch: 49%, Double clutch: 34%
17. Darius Garland
Clutch: 50%, Double Clutch: 31% in 13 attempts
18. Jimmy Butler
Clutch: 40%, Double clutch: 29% on 19 attempts
19. Jayson Tatum
Clutch: 51%, Double clutch: 24% in 19 attempts
